Using the linear equation, y = mx +b and solve for B<br> (7,1)(-12,-6)
Ilia_Sergeevich [38]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

first we need to find the slope bu using the slope formula and ur two sets of points

slope = (y2 - y1) / (x2 - x1)

(7,1)...x1 = 7 and y1 = 1

(-12,-6)....x2 = -12 and y2 = -6

now we sub

slope = (-6 - 1) / (-12 - 7) = -7/-19 = 7/19

now...in y = mx + b form, the slope will be in them position

y = mx + b

slope(m) = 7/19

use either of ur points.....(7,1)...x = 7 and y = 1

now we sub and find b, the y int

1 = 7/19(7) + b

1 = 49/19 + b

1 - 49/19 = b

19/19 - 49/19 = b

- 30/19 = b <======= ur y int

so ur equation is : y = 7/19x - 30/19
